Remembering Sharon Jones With ‘8 Days (Of Hanukkah)’
Soul singer Sharon Jones, whose work with the band the Dap-Kings earned her a Grammy nomination in 2014, passed away on Friday. She had battled pancreatic cancer since 2013, a period chronicled by Barbara Kopple in the documentary “Miss Sharon Jones!”
Jones was known for her extraordinary energy as a performer, a quality that proved compelling as, with the Dap-Kings, she worked to reinvigorate the spirit of funk and soul music from its heyday in the 1960s and 70s. Remember her with their song “8 Days (of Hanukkah),” which was included on the band’s 2015 album “It’s a Holiday Soul Party.”
“8 days of Hanukkah,” Jones sings on the track, “every one of them glows with love.” For fans of all faiths, her music will carry that glow forward.
